Bloglar

XML Entegrasyonu: E-Ticaret İşinizde Otomasyonu Sağlamanın Yolu

XML Entegrasyonu: E-Ticaret İşinizde Otomasyonu Sağlamanın Yolu

XML entegrasyonu, e-ticaret siteleri ile tedarikçiler arasında ürün, fiyat, stok ve diğer bilgilerin otomatik olarak paylaşılmasını sağlayan bir teknolojidir. XML, yani Extensible Markup Language (Genişletilebilir Biçimlendirme Dili), verilerin düzenli ve tutarlı bir şekilde paylaşılması için kullanılır. E-ticaret sitenize XML entegrasyonu yaparak, ürün yönetim süreçlerini hızlandırabilir, manuel işlemleri azaltabilir ve işinizi daha verimli hale getirebilirsiniz.

Peki, XML entegrasyonu nedir ve nasıl yapılır? İşte adım adım XML entegrasyonu süreci:

1. XML Nedir ve Neden Kullanılır?

XML, tedarikçiler tarafından ürün verilerini paylaşmak için kullanılan bir veri formatıdır. İçeriğinde ürün isimleri, açıklamaları, stok bilgileri, fiyatlar, görseller ve diğer önemli bilgiler yer alır. Bu veri formatı, e-ticaret sitelerine ürünlerin hızlı ve doğru bir şekilde eklenmesini sağlar. XML entegrasyonu sayesinde tedarikçiden gelen veriler sitenize otomatik olarak aktarılır ve güncellenir. Böylece stokta tükenme, fiyat değişikliği gibi durumlar anında sitenize yansır.

2. XML Entegrasyonu için Hazırlık

XML entegrasyonu yapabilmek için, öncelikle çalışmak istediğiniz tedarikçiden XML dosyalarını veya URL’lerini talep etmelisiniz. Tedarikçi, size bir XML dosyası veya canlı bir XML feed (akış) sağlayacaktır. Bu dosya, e-ticaret sitenizde kullanılacak tüm ürün bilgilerini içerir. Ayrıca, entegrasyonu gerçekleştirmek için sitenizin teknik alt yapısının XML verilerini kabul edebilecek şekilde hazırlanması gerekir.

Hazırlık aşamasında dikkat edilmesi gerekenler:

  • Tedarikçiden gelen XML dosyasında hangi bilgilerin yer aldığını inceleyin (ürün isimleri, fiyatlar, stok bilgileri, açıklamalar, vb.).
  • XML entegrasyonuna uygun bir e-ticaret platformu kullanıyorsanız (WooCommerce, Shopify, Magento, OpenCart vb.), bu platformun XML entegrasyonunu destekleyip desteklemediğini kontrol edin.

3. XML Dosyasını Anlamak

Bir XML dosyası, genellikle ağaç yapısında düzenlenmiş veri parçalarından oluşur. XML dosyasını açtığınızda şu temel unsurları görmelisiniz:

  • <ürün>: Her bir ürünün başlangıç etiketi.
  • <ürün_kodu>, <ürün_ismi>, <fiyat>, <stok> gibi etiketler: Ürünle ilgili bilgilerin yer aldığı alanlar.
  • </ürün>: Ürünün bitiş etiketi.

Örneğin, bir XML dosyasında şu şekilde bilgiler yer alabilir:

xmlKodu kopyala<ürünler>
  <ürün>
    <ürün_kodu>12345</ürün_kodu>
    <ürün_ismi>Şık Kadın Bluz</ürün_ismi>
    <fiyat>150.00</fiyat>
    <stok>100</stok>
    <görsel>https://site.com/bluz.jpg</görsel>
  </ürün>
</ürünler>

Bu yapıdaki veriler, ürünleri doğru şekilde tanımlamak için kullanılır.

4. XML Entegrasyon Araçlarını Kullanma

Birçok e-ticaret platformu, XML entegrasyonunu kolaylaştırmak için hazır araçlar veya eklentiler sunar. Bu araçlar, XML verilerini düzenli bir şekilde sitenize entegre etmenizi sağlar. Örneğin:

  • WooCommerce için “WP All Import” gibi eklentiler kullanarak XML dosyasındaki verileri sitenize aktarabilirsiniz.
  • Shopify için “Stock Sync” gibi uygulamalarla XML akışlarını yönetebilirsiniz.
  • Magento ve OpenCart gibi platformlar da XML entegrasyonları için benzer modüller sunar.

Bu entegrasyon araçlarını kullanarak tedarikçiden gelen XML dosyasını yükleyebilir ve ürünlerin otomatik olarak sitenize eklenmesini sağlayabilirsiniz.

5. Otomatik Güncellemeler

XML entegrasyonu sayesinde tedarikçilerinizden gelen ürünler, stoklar ve fiyatlar otomatik olarak güncellenir. Bu, sitenizde manuel olarak veri girişi yapmanıza gerek kalmadan güncel kalmanızı sağlar. Örneğin, tedarikçinizin stoğunda bir ürün tükenirse, bu bilgi otomatik olarak sitenize yansır ve o ürünü satışa kapatabilirsiniz. Aynı şekilde, fiyat değişiklikleri de anında sitenize aktarılır.

6. XML Entegrasyonunu Test Etme

XML entegrasyonunu tamamladıktan sonra, her şeyin düzgün çalıştığından emin olmanız gerekir. Test aşamasında şu adımları izleyin:

  • Ürün bilgileri doğru bir şekilde aktarılıyor mu?
  • Fiyatlar ve stoklar düzenli olarak güncelleniyor mu?
  • Görseller ve açıklamalar düzgün şekilde sitenize yansıyor mu?
  • XML entegrasyonuyla ilgili herhangi bir hata veya eksik veri var mı?

Bu kontrolleri yaptıktan sonra, XML entegrasyonunuzun sorunsuz bir şekilde çalıştığından emin olabilirsiniz.

7. Tedarikçi ile Düzenli İletişim

XML entegrasyonunu etkin bir şekilde kullanmak için tedarikçinizle sürekli iletişimde kalmalısınız. Tedarikçinizin sağladığı XML feed’inde herhangi bir değişiklik olursa, bu güncellemeleri takip etmeli ve entegrasyonunuzu buna göre düzenlemelisiniz. Ayrıca, tedarikçinizle çalışmayı sürdürdüğünüz sürece, XML verilerinin güncelliğini korumak için periyodik kontroller yapmalısınız.

Sonuç: XML Entegrasyonu ile Verimliliği Artırın

XML entegrasyonu, e-ticaret işinizde manuel iş yükünü azaltan, stok ve fiyat güncellemelerini otomatikleştiren güçlü bir araçtır. Bu entegrasyonu doğru bir şekilde kurduğunuzda, ürün yönetimi süreçleriniz hızlanır ve müşterilerinize her zaman güncel bilgiler sunabilirsiniz. E-ticarette başarıya ulaşmak için XML entegrasyonu, özellikle geniş ürün yelpazesine sahip mağazalar için kaçınılmaz bir çözümdür.

XML entegrasyonu ile işinizi daha verimli hale getirin ve zamandan tasarruf ederken satışlarınızı artırın!

Benzerler

Leave a Comment